“Fighting Terrorism in Ukraine”

A representative of law enforcement agencies of Myrhorod held a lecture on the topic: “Fighting Terrorism in Ukraine.”

On November 16, Luhansk Taras Shevchenko National University hosted an online meeting with a representative of law enforcement agencies of Myrhorod, organized in accordance with the letter of the Security Service of Ukraine dated October 19, 2023 and in accordance with paragraph 3 of the order of the Cabinet of Ministers of Ukraine dated January 5, 2021 “On approval of the plan of measures for the implementation Concepts of combating terrorism in Ukraine”.

The meeting was attended by leaders, teachers and students of institutes, faculties and colleges of Luhansk Taras Shevchenko National University, located in the following cities: Poltava, Lubny and Myrhorod.
In response to the official request, the head of the sector of the juvenile province of the Myrhorod District Police Department in the Poltava region, police captain Yanina Serhiyivna Zahoda, joined the meeting and read a lecture on the topic: “Fighting Terrorism in Ukraine.”

Yanina Zahoda informed the listeners about the danger and scale of terrorist threats in Ukraine; entities that directly carry out the fight against terrorism within the limits of their competence. She also emphasized that citizens of Ukraine, on the basis of trust and cooperation, can inform the Security Service of Ukraine about any facts of the arrival and stay of suspicious persons in the region, intentions to carry out terrorist, subversive or intelligence-subversive activities.

At the end of the meeting, everyone had the opportunity to get answers to their questions.
